Output 0421f952926b8c79a355516901a123ccf2e0320903e2fe13049026de78150394:0

value
5699412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f712e93360a03c480cb376876b3dd3ae64fd0e OP_EQUAL
address
3Gur5P4JVK6jw6ivfweCzWTZzUEiBHwqM1
transaction
0421f952926b8c79a355516901a123ccf2e0320903e2fe13049026de78150394
spent
true